The cheapest way to get from Monterey to Irvine is to shuttle which costs $60 - $95 and takes 13h 20m.
The fastest way to get from Monterey to Irvine is to shuttle and fly which takes 4h and costs $120 - $550.
No, there is no direct bus from Monterey to Irvine. However, there are services departing from Tyler / Franklin and arriving at Main-Harvard via Salinas, San Jose Diridon Station and Artic - Dock 4.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 13h 50m.
The distance between Monterey and Irvine is 421 miles. The road distance is 359.9 miles.
The best way to get from Monterey to Irvine without a car is to train which takes 13h 3m and costs $85 - $140.
It takes approximately 4h to get from Monterey to Irvine, including transfers.
Monterey to Irvine bus services, operated by Amtrak, depart from Salinas station.
The best way to get from Monterey to Irvine is to train which takes 13h 3m and costs $85 - $140.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s and takes 13h 50m.
Monterey to Irvine bus services, operated by Amtrak, arrive at San Jose station.
Yes, the driving distance between Monterey to Irvine is 360 miles. It takes approximately 6h 16m to drive from Monterey to Irvine.
